Know Your Products To Improve Affiliate Marketing Success

Promoting a product or range of products requires that you provide accurate and appealing information to potential buyers. For affiliate marketing websites this can prove difficult especially for those sites that sell a large range of products or high ticket price items. Most affiliate marketing websites do benefit if the marketer has used or owned the product they are selling but it isn't completely essential. Many websites will be vying for leads. Affiliate marketing works in such a way that each program is designed to attract as many publishers as possible and even new or less competitive programs will mean competing with several other websites. Original content will help to drive traffic and enables you, as a marketer, to offer your own slant and your own perceived benefits of a product. Do as much research on each product as possible, especially if you do not have first hand experience. Read the manufacturers or retailers reviews and do your own research into consumer reviews and opinions. Determine the best features and play to these while also trying to approach the product from a specific niche angle. Niche affiliate marketing can generate excellent results and no one product is tied down to a single niche. While owning or using a particular product isn't necessary to your affiliate marketing efforts, researching that product is essential because it will help you give an honest and informed point of view and can also give you some direction in marketing it towards particular niches or groups of people.
